Wu-Tang Clan to release new album without Raekwon
Wu-Tang Clan’s new album (not the one that will cost you millions) has been heavily delayed due to (no surprises) in-fighting, and in particular Raekwon’s marked absence from the recording process. Now, in a new interview, RZA has hinted that the rapper won’t feature on the release at all.
“Raekwon has not been participating with that particular record. I haven’t had a chance to really talk to him about why not. All I see is the press going back and forth,” RZA told Vlad TV.
He continued: “But I would say that maybe creatively we on different paths. I’m creatively different than I was in the ‘90s”
A Better Tomorrow is expected later this year, along with the very limited-edition record Once Upon A Time In Shaolin.
